How many of you are happy when you see a reflection of yourself in some water? Do you ever feel satisfied when you see your reflection?
I hope with this post it will encourage you to be happy and be confidence when you look at your reflection in the water.
Proverbs 27:19-20 says: "As water reflects the face, so one's life reflects the heart. Death and destruction are never satisfied, and neither are human eyes."
What do you get from that verse? What I get from that verse in that your life reflects your heart. Death and destruction are never satisfied is tougher. That is where your heart gets into a battle. When death and destruction deceive you and keep you unsatisfied, your heart is not happy. Since your heart reflects your life, a sad heart, will more or less mean a sad life. Or a sad situation.
With that being said, we think that our lives are so much more than what they really are.
Psalm 103:14-16 says: "for he knows how we are formed, he remembers that we are dust. The life of mortals is like grass, they flourish like a flower of the field; the wind blows over it and it is gone, and its place remembers it no more."
God knows how we were formed. We are dust. Our life is like grass that slowly withers away and will eventually be gone. How does this relate to how ones life reflects the heart? Or lives are so short that we should never get caught up in negativity, or anything that makes us unhappy. We need to guard our hearts and focus on the one thing that will always be the same and will never ever change.
Our God is so good. I encourage you to really meditate on this scripture. Psalm 103:8-12 says: "The LORD is compassionate and gracious, slow to anger, abounding in love. He will not always accuse, nor will he harbor his anger forever; he does not treat us as our sins deserve or repay us according to our iniquities. For as high as the heavens are above the earth, so great is his love for those who fear him; as far as the east is from the west, so far has he removed our transgressions from us."
Those verses are filled with so much truth and so much power.
There is one verse I want to close with and it is Psalm 102:12 which says: "But you, Lord, sit enthroned forever; your renown endures through all generations."
The Lord is enthroned forever. Believe in the with all of your heart and you will be happy in this life.
